(1) [Subject to the other provisions of this Act, so much of the Electoral rolls of any Assembly Constituency or, as the case may be, Assembly Constituencies, for the time being in force, as relates to the area comprised within the Gram Panchayats, shall be the Electoral Rolls for the election of members of Gram Panchayat, Panchayat Samiti and Zilla parishad. (3) For the purpose of the preparation of the Electoral Rolls of each constituency of the Gram Panchayat, Panchayat Samiti and Zilla Parishad, Electoral Roll of any assembly constituency, or, as the case may be, Assembly Constituencies, shall be split up in such manner as the Electoral Registration Officer may consider fit, proper and necessary. (4) Electoral Rolls of each constituency of the Gram Panchayat, Panchayat Samiti and Zilla Parishad, may be divided into convenient parts which shall be numbered consecutively and shall be prepared in the form as may be prescribed by the State Election Commissioner in Bengali or if so directed by the State Government in any other language. Provided that wherever necessary, the split up Rolls referred to in Sub-section (3) may be consolidated and in such event, the serial number of the electors may be renumbered so as to ensure consecutive serial numbers of the electors of each part. (5) The Electoral Registration Officer shall publish the roll for a constituency or, as the case may be, constituencies of the Gram Panchayat, Panchayat Samiti and Zilla Parishad in draft by making a copy of thereof available for inspection and displaying the notice in the form as may be prescribed by the State Election Commissioner at his office and at such place or places in the constituency, as may be specified by him for the purpose, if his office is outside the constituency; Provided that such Electoral Rolls may be published in draft either printed or otherwise as may be directed by the State Election Commissioner. Provided further that such publication of Electoral Rolls in draft shall be made on the date appointed by the State Election Commissioner under Sub-section (2) of Section 178. (6) As soon as the Electoral Rolls for a constituency are published in draft in accordance with the provision of Sub-section (5) above, the Electoral Registration Officer shall also give publicity as widely as possible by a beat of drum or otherwise within the constituency that the Electoral Rolls have been published and may 134 be inspected at his office during office hours on all working days and may also state in the notice, in the form as may be prescribed by the State Election Commissioner, the other places at which the Electoral Rolls may be inspected.]1
